Josh Rouse: The Warm Voice of Americana and Indie Folk

Josh Rouse is an American singer-songwriter known for his melodic, introspective blend of folk, rock, and Americana. Hailing from Nebraska, he built a dedicated international following, particularly in Europe, with albums like 1972 and Nashville achieving critical acclaim and solidifying his reputation as a master craftsman of heartfelt songwriting.

Early career

Born in 1972 in Paxton, Nebraska, Josh Rouse began playing guitar and writing songs after moving to Tennessee. His official debut came with the 1998 album Dressed Up Like Nebraska on the Slow River label, a collection of hushed, melancholic tunes that immediately established his signature sound and lyrical warmth.

Breakthrough

Rouse's commercial and critical breakthrough arrived in 2003 with the album 1972, released on Rykodisc. The album's nostalgic yet fresh take on 70s singer-songwriter pop resonated strongly, with singles like "Love Vibration" becoming staples and leading to extensive touring and heightened recognition.

Following his success, Rouse continued a prolific output, releasing albums like Subtítulo and El Turista, the latter reflecting his life in Spain and incorporating Latin influences. He has collaborated with artists like Paz Suay and his work has been featured in numerous films and television shows, building a durable and respected catalog.
